Appihalli - Belur, Hassan

Appihalli is a village situated in the Belur taluka of Hassan district, Karnataka. It is located approximately 34 km from the tehsil headquarters in Belur and around 40 km from the district headquarters in Hassan. Gangur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Appihalli village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Appihalli is 615305. The village covers a total geographical area of 154.11 hectares and falls under the 573125 pincode. Belur is the nearest town, located about 34 km away.

Appihalli village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Belur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Hassan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Appihalli

As per Census 2011, Appihalli village has a total population of 443 people, consisting of 215 males and 228 females. The village has 118 households and a sex ratio of 1,060 females per 1,000 males. There are 28 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 356 literate and 87 illiterate residents. Additionally, 8 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Appihalli

Appihalli is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Habanghata, while the nearest airport is Mysore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 96.8 km.
